Here's a suggestion for this script to make it work in more places (such as users who have a custom friends layout). All you have to do is change one line: selectedLinks = document.evaluate("//a[img[contains(@src, '_s.')]]", document, null, XPathResult.UNORDERED_NODE_SNAPSHOT_TYPE, null); to: selectedLinks = document.evaluate("//a[img and contains(@href, '.viewprofile')]", document, null, XPathResult.UNORDERED_NODE_SNAPSHOT_TYPE, null); this makes the images bind to any image link to someone's profile, instead of any link with an image ending in '_s'.

I added these excludes for my own preference (mainly to avoid people with css to resize comments)

// @exclude http://*.myspace.com/*.viewCategory*
// @exclude http://profile.myspace.com/*

the first exclude is to avoid those contact buttons from showing up on the forum/group listings, because they stack up in that limited area.
